Abstract

Aspects described herein generally relate to a cleaning system, such as a cleaning implement with a primary cleaning member and a removable secondary cleaning member, in particular a mop assembly with a primary cleaning member and a removable secondary cleaning member. The primary cleaning member may be a sponge based cleaning member and the secondary cleaning member may be a scrubbing brush or similar handheld scrubbing member. The scrubbing brush may have an attachment member that includes a pair of rails and a tab assembly that helps to releasably connect the scrubbing brush to a connecting member of the mop assembly.
